📝 Color Information for #CF598A

The hexadecimal color code #CF598A represents a medium shade in the red family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 207 red, 89 green, and 138 blue, which translates to approximately 81% red, 35% green, and 54% blue. This makes it a moderately saturated color with warm und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#CF598A has a hue of 335 degrees, a saturation level of 55%, and a lightness value of 58%. The hue angle of 335° places this color firmly in the red sp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 335°, saturation of 57%, and brightness/value of 81%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#CF598A would be reproduced using 0% cyan, 57% magenta, 33% yellow, and 19% black. The closest web-safe color is #CC6699,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. With its medium lightness, it's versatile enough for both foreground elements and subtle backgrounds. The moderate to low saturation gives this color a sophisticated, muted quality that works well in professional and minimalist designs. When pairing #CF598A with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 155°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 13588874,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#CF598A? +

The approximate CMYK value of #CF598A is C:0% M:57% Y:33% K:19%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
